drcorey wrote: People can look out and see disney charactors having fun on the ocean. are these real portholes with video overlays, or just video monitors placed to look like they are real?

Disney has some neat technology. if they really wanted to play with our minds, no one would know.
The magic portholes are clever. The HD feed is from a camera facing in the direction that you would be looking were that an outside cabin. It allows the image to stay in sync with teh motion of the ship that you are feeling. we enjoyed ours, but found that we left it off most of the time. It was handy for checking if it was raining ooutside however. the visits from characters were about every 30 minutes if I remember correctly. The magic portholes sell out first, so the real porthole is often a cheaper cabin now on the Dream and Fantasy. On our next cruise we will have our first outside cabin, an oversize aft balcony on the Dream. I doubt we will miss the porthole.

The more fascinating tech for me was in the skyline lounge, where the "windows" are huge plasma screens, showing a wide screen hi def night scene of various cities. The city changes every 20 minutes, along with the artwork and soundtrack. Tinkerbell flys in and sprinkles pixie dust, and the room changes. Combine that with some high octane adult drinks...
